Transaction 517a8c9811730233134edc77676a52f361d749910c341aba09a11381d60d52fe

10 Input
2 Outputs
  • 517a8c9811730233134edc77676a52f361d749910c341aba09a11381d60d52fe:0
  • value  135306959
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 517a8c9811730233134edc77676a52f361d749910c341aba09a11381d60d52fe:1
  • value  1600
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h